Aims to promote personal responsibility and self-sufficiency through work. Able-bodied recipients are required to participate in a work-related activity. All WFNJ recipients who are participating in an approved work activity are eligible to receive monthly bus passes or daily tickets in order to get to their activity site. Long-term recipients are also provided with intensive case management services to assist clients in becoming more self-sufficient.
